Residential glass replacement services involve removing damaged or outdated glass from windows, doors, or other glass fixtures in a home and installing new, clear, and secure glass panels. This process typically begins with an assessment of the existing glass to determine the best type of replacement. Skilled service providers handle the removal of broken or cracked glass carefully to prevent further damage and ensure a clean, precise fit for the new panel. Once the old glass is safely removed, the new glass is measured, cut, and installed to match the original specifications, restoring the appearance and functionality of the affected area.
This service helps resolve a variety of common problems homeowners encounter. Cracked or shattered windows can compromise security and insulation, leading to higher energy bills and potential safety hazards. Foggy or cloudy glass may obscure visibility and diminish natural light, while broken or damaged glass in doors can affect privacy and safety. Additionally, older windows with deteriorating glass may no longer provide proper insulation, making it necessary to replace the glass to improve energy efficiency. Residential glass replacement offers a practical solution to these issues, restoring the integrity and appearance of a home’s glass fixtures.

The overview below groups typical Residential Glass Replacement proj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Reading, PA.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- typical costs for minor glass replacements like a broken window or small pane generally range from $250-$600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on glass size and type. Fewer projects push into the higher tiers unless additional repairs are needed.
Full Window Replacements - replacing an entire window unit can cost between $500 and $1,200 for standard sizes. Larger or more customized windows tend to be at the higher end of this range, with many projects completing in the middle.
Large or Complex Projects - extensive glass replacements, such as multiple large panes or specialty glass, can reach $2,000-$5,000 or more. These are less common but are necessary for high-end or custom installations requiring detailed work.
Emergency or Same-Day Services - urgent repairs or quick turnaround jobs often cost between $300 and $800 extra, depending on the scope. Such projects are typically within the lower to middle ranges but can vary based on urgency and accessibility.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
